This is a known issue: there are a good few duplicates in the tracker. Issue #1662581 is one, for example.
In this particular case, you can probably fix things by tightening up your regex. Part of the problem is that '.*' is going to match any sequence of characters, including spaces. Judicious use of '\S' to match non-whitespace characters might help. There's not much point to the '?' in '.*?', either. |
